UPEI is committed to encouraging and fostering critical, creative, and independent thinking. UPEI's 200-member faculty provides a rich blend of academic programs in Arts, Science, Business, Education, Nursing and Veterinary Medicine to over 3,500 full- and part-time students. Graduate programs, internship opportunities, and exchange programs are offered. UPEI received top marks from its graduates for availability of faculty members, class size, quality of teaching, and for the level of satisfaction in the investment of time and money in acquiring a UPEI degree. Every year, the University of Prince Edward Island welcomes students from around the world and provides them with a unique learning environment - a learning environment that is student-centered and community-oriented.
Student Exchange Program (IOP01): Program offered to Computer Science, Business Administration and International Trade, Mass Communication and Alsun (Languages and Translation) students. Double Degree Programs (IOP02): Program offered to Faculty of Alsun students and Computer Science students. Students spend three years at MIU and one year at University of Prince Edward Island and get a bachelor's degree from both universities. Faculty Exchange Program/Visiting Professor Program (IOP04): Participating faculties: Computer Science, Business Administration and International Trade, and Mass Communication and Alsun (Languages and Translation). Intensive language Summer School Program IOP05 MIU students can attend a summer English course at University of Prince Edward Island.
